WALTHAM, MA – NJIT men and women's fencing competed at the Eric Sollee Invitational on Saturday hosted by Brandeis, with the men going undefeated.
The Highlander men went 6-0 defeating Brown 15-12, Haverford 20-7, MIT 17-10, Stevens 20-7, Boston College 16-11 and Brandeis 14-13.
On the sabre strip,
Greg Puccio finished 14-4 on the day and was the only Highlander to post a win against every team. Teammate
Thomas Slawinski earned a 13-5 record with 3-0 wins against Haverford, MIT and Stevens.
The men's foil squad was let by
Simon Rizell who posted a 13-5 record, and
Chris Saulys posted a 12-5 record going undefeated against Haverford, MIT and Stevens.
Henrique Marques competed only against Brown and Brandies and compiled a 4-2 record.
Every member of the men's epee squad scored a 60% or higher winning percentage. Leading the pack was freshman
Brett Bogert who notched a 13-5 record. Teammate
Eduardo Ezcurra went 16-6 on the day and
Gal Gluhic earned a 9-6 record. Freshman
Thomas Manley posted a 3-2 only competing against MIT and Stevens.
The NJIT women went 0-6 at the invitational, losing to Brown, Haverford and Boston College 14-13, 17-10 to MIT, 20-7 to Stevens and 15-12 to Brandeis.
The women's top performer was
Jule Shigihara on the foil strip, who boasted a 15-3 record at the invite and was the only woman to defeat all teams going 3-0 against Brown, Boston College and Brandeis, and winning 2-1 against Haverford, MIT and Stevens.
Cristina Garcia Mendicino earned herself a 9-3 record in foil.
In women's epee
Julia Garcia and
Maria Sztan were the Highlanders top performers. Senior Garcia went 12-3 while junior Sztan posted a 12-6 record.
The NJIT men have the MACFA B Round Robin hosted by Stevens on February 10 starting at 8am while the women have a break until February 25 where they will compete at the Fairleigh Dickinson Invitational.
